We’re reminded yet again that temperatures in the triple digits are nothing to mess around with as the Arkansas Department of Heath confirmed the first heat-related death in the state this summer on Monday.
A department spokesperson wouldn’t say where or when the unnamed individual died, according to Arkansas News.
